Skip to content
View in the app

A better way to browse. Learn more.

Unraid

A full-screen app on your home screen with push notifications, badges and more.

To install this app on iOS and iPadOS
  1. Tap the Share icon in Safari
  2. Scroll the menu and tap Add to Home Screen.
  3. Tap Add in the top-right corner.
To install this app on Android
  1. Tap the 3-dot menu (⋮) in the top-right corner of the browser.
  2. Tap Add to Home screen or Install app.
  3. Confirm by tapping Install.

Help : BTRFS Errors

Featured Replies

Hey guys i need some help with my unraid server, so the thing yesterday i noticed that my MD1 drive was throwing some ATA read errors.

and when i tried a recently added data it was throwing these errors.

BTRFS error (device md1): parent transid verify failed on 475906048 wanted 21896 found 21309

So after reseating the cable those ATA read errors are gone but this morning when i checked logs, now it showing these BTRFS errors.

Dec  1 03:40:25 Unraid kernel: BTRFS error (device md1): parent transid verify failed on 475906048 wanted 21896 found 21309
Dec  1 03:40:25 Unraid kernel: BTRFS error (device md1): parent transid verify failed on 475906048 wanted 21896 found 21309
Dec  1 03:40:25 Unraid kernel: BTRFS: error (device md1: state A) in do_free_extent_accounting:2852: errno=-5 IO failure
Dec  1 03:40:25 Unraid kernel: BTRFS: error (device md1: state EA) in btrfs_run_delayed_refs:2157: errno=-5 IO failure

Any idea what could be the cause of these errors and what can i do to fix these.

unraid.local-diagnostics-20221201-0856.zip

7 hours ago, Max said:
parent transid verify failed on 475906048 wanted 21896 found 21309

This error is fatal, it means some writes were lost and the device/controller lied about them, it's usually a device firmware or controller problem, you should backup the data and re-format the disk.

 

Also note that there's corruption detected on disk2, you should run a scrub.

  • Author
On 12/1/2022 at 4:12 PM, JorgeB said:

This error is fatal, it means some writes were lost and the device/controller lied about them, it's usually a device firmware or controller problem, you should backup the data and re-format the disk.

okay will do but just now when i tried to access that data which first showed that error is now again showing this error.

ec  2 22:22:41 Unraid kernel: BTRFS error (device md1: state EA): parent transid verify failed on 37945344 wanted 22027 found 20712
Dec  2 22:22:41 Unraid kernel: BTRFS error (device md1: state EA): parent transid verify failed on 37945344 wanted 22027 found 20712
Dec  2 22:22:41 Unraid kernel: BTRFS error (device md1: state EA): parent transid verify failed on 37945344 wanted 22027 found 20712
Dec  2 22:22:41 Unraid kernel: BTRFS error (device md1: state EA): parent transid verify failed on 37945344 wanted 22027 found 20712
Dec  2 22:22:41 Unraid kernel: BTRFS error (device md1: state EA): parent transid verify failed on 37945344 wanted 22027 found 20712
Dec  2 22:22:41 Unraid kernel: BTRFS error (device md1: state EA): parent transid verify failed on 37945344 wanted 22027 found 20712
Dec  2 22:22:41 Unraid kernel: BTRFS error (device md1: state EA): parent transid verify failed on 37945344 wanted 22027 found 20712
Dec  2 22:22:41 Unraid kernel: BTRFS error (device md1: state EA): parent transid verify failed on 37945344 wanted 22027 found 20712
Dec  2 22:22:41 Unraid kernel: BTRFS error (device md1: state EA): parent transid verify failed on 37945344 wanted 22027 found 20712
Dec  2 22:22:41 Unraid kernel: BTRFS error (device md1: state EA): parent transid verify failed on 37945344 wanted 22027 found 20712

i also tried scrubing disk 1 but it just aborts instantly on its own.

 

On 12/1/2022 at 4:12 PM, JorgeB said:

Also note that there's corruption detected on disk2, you should run a scrub.

tried this scrub didn't find any errors.

unraid.local-diagnostics-20221202-2231.zip

Also today scheduled parity check ran it found more than 42K errors.

 

Edited by Max

Like mentioned that error is fatal, you need to re-format, if the fs doesn't mount now you can use btrsf restore to try and recover the data, option #2 here.

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.
Note: Your post will require moderator approval before it will be visible.

Guest
Reply to this topic...

Account

Navigation

Search

Search

Configure browser push notifications

Chrome (Android)
  1. Tap the lock icon next to the address bar.
  2. Tap Permissions → Notifications.
  3. Adjust your preference.
Chrome (Desktop)
  1. Click the padlock icon in the address bar.
  2. Select Site settings.
  3. Find Notifications and adjust your preference.